What is a transponder key?

A transponder car key is a key that comes with a security feature to prevent theft included. This is accomplished by incorporating the microchip that is used for radio frequency identification into the head of the key. The chip is used to relay a signal to the immobilizer system of your car when the ignition is turned on. This chip prevents the hot-wiring process and makes it extremely difficult to steal the vehicle.

It isn't the case that transponder keys are foolproof. While they do provide an additional layer of security but criminals still have the capability to employ their skills to break into vehicles. It takes a lot more time and effort to do this, which is why they are a fantastic security option for anyone who is concerned about the safety of their vehicle.

Transponder keys are very simple to use. The microchip that is embedded in the head of the key is programmed with a unique digital serial number that is linked to the immobilizer system in your vehicle. When you put the key in the ignition the immobilizer will recognize the serial number and validate it. If it is in fact the same, the engine will start and if it doesn't, the car will not start.

There are several different types of transponder chips that are able to be programmed. The type of chip your vehicle uses will determine the kind of key you have. Search engines and professional locksmiths can assist you in finding the correct transponder to match your vehicle.

In general transponder keys are more expensive to replace than non-transponder keys as they come with the additional expense of a microchip. The dealership that you use for your vehicle is the most expensive alternative for a replacement key due to the most expensive overhead costs, however you can also contact an expert locksmith to obtain your new key.

Another important thing to remember is that you can only program the transponder key only in the event that it hasn't been cut previously. You can do it yourself if you purchase the transponder from one of the stores that provide these services. But, you'll require a specific tool in order to complete this task.

What is the process to program a transponder key?

A car reprogramming key fob with chip inside is a kind of transponder key. They are designed to prevent theft of vehicles by ensuring that only the correct key can start the car. If you've lost the key or the chip is damaged, a locksmith is able to make a replacement for you. In most cases, programming a chip key is a fairly straightforward and easy process. However, some vehicles require specialized equipment to program the key.

The first step in the process is to determine the type of key you have. It is essential to be aware of the make, model and year of your car to ensure that you have the proper key blank. Some keys have a transponder in the key head, whereas others do not. If your key has a chip and the bow cover (the plastic part at the top of the key) will be heavier than on a chip-free key. It is also possible to determine if your key has chips by looking at the ignition. If the key has a push-to-start button instead of a hole, it is likely to have a chip.

The next step is to decide which method of programming will be used. Some transponder keys can be programmed using onboard diagnostics while others require a specialized key programming device. The device used to program keys must be compatible with the key circuitboard or transponder that is being utilized. It should also function at the same frequency of the car's computer onboard.
